Interview Process Overview

The interview process for a Machine Learning Engineer at Covar is thorough and designed to evaluate candidates across multiple dimensions of software engineering and machine learning theory. The process typically spans four distinct stages, beginning with initial conversations and culminating in a comprehensive virtual or on-site loop.

The journey begins with a standard video screening involving HR and a technical team member to align on background, experience, and mutual expectations. Following a successful screen, candidates progress to a dedicated coding assessment and an ML breadth interview. The final stage is a rigorous, full-day series of interviews that includes a technical presentation and multiple collaborative sessions with engineers from different divisions.

Deep Dive into Evaluation Areas

Coding and Data Structures

The coding portion of the interview process focuses heavily on your proficiency with Python and your ability to solve fundamental algorithmic challenges. Rather than focusing on highly complex, abstract competitive programming questions, Covar typically assesses your mastery of core data structures, such as lists, dictionaries, and strings.

Be ready to go over:

  • List and Array Manipulations – Sorting, filtering, and transforming sequences efficiently.
  • Dictionary and Hash Map Operations – Utilizing key-value stores for fast lookups, frequency counting, and data organization.

Frequently Asked Questions

Q: How difficult is the Covar Machine Learning Engineer interview process? A: The process is generally considered highly rigorous and technically demanding, particularly during the ML breadth and presentation rounds. While the initial coding screens focus on fundamental Python and data structures, the final loop requires deep theoretical knowledge and strong communication skills to pass.

Q: What is the typical timeline from the initial screen to an offer? A: The timeline can vary significantly depending on team bandwidth and scheduling. Some candidates report a swift process of a few weeks, while others have experienced longer timelines. It is recommended to maintain active communication with your recruiter throughout the process.

Q: How should I prepare for the technical presentation during the on-site? A: Choose a project where you had significant ownership and technical impact. Structure your presentation clearly, focusing on the problem statement, the technical challenges, your specific approach, the trade-offs you made, and the final results. Be prepared for deep technical questions from the panel.

Q: Does Covar support remote work for this position? A: While Covar has hubs in Durham, NC, and McLean, VA, specific hybrid or remote arrangements depend on the team, project requirements, and security clearance levels associated with certain client contracts. You should clarify location expectations during your initial HR screening.

Other General Tips

  • Prepare for the ML Vocab Round: The ML breadth interview is unique in that it maps your familiarity across a wide range of topics. Be honest about what you know; it is much better to say you are unfamiliar with a concept than to try to bluff your way through, as interviewers will drill down deeply into the topics you claim to understand.
  • Focus on Clean Python Code: For the coding screen, prioritize writing clean, readable, and idiomatic Python. Use descriptive variable names, handle edge cases, and talk through your thought process as you write your code.

  • Structure Your Presentation for a Broad Audience: Remember that the final loop presentation will be attended by engineers from different divisions. Ensure your slides and explanation are accessible to systems engineers and product specialists, not just pure ML researchers.

  • Emphasize Your Collaborative Nature: Covar values team players who can work across divisional boundaries. In your behavioral and pair interviews, highlight instances where you successfully collaborated with other teams, resolved technical disagreements constructively, and aligned your work with broader business goals.
